세일즈포스 MCP 서버

AI Salesforce Integration Automation

FlowHunt에서 MCP 서버를 호스팅하려면 문의하세요

“세일즈포스” MCP 서버는 무엇을 하나요?

세일즈포스 MCP(Model Context Protocol) 서버는 AI 어시스턴트와 대형 언어 모델(LLM)이 세일즈포스 데이터와 직접 상호작용할 수 있도록 해주는 커넥터 역할을 합니다. 세일즈포스의 강력한 API들을 제공하여, SOQL로 데이터베이스 쿼리, SOSL로 검색, 메타데이터 조회, 레코드 관리, 툴링/REST API 요청 실행 등 다양한 개발 워크플로우를 지원합니다. 이 서버는 AI 클라이언트와 세일즈포스 간의 통합을 간소화하여, 개발자와 AI 에이전트가 업무 프로세스를 자동화하고 인사이트를 추출하며 세일즈포스 리소스를 프로그래밍 방식으로 관리할 수 있게 해줍니다. 이 연결성은 세일즈포스의 데이터와 서비스를 어떤 AI 기반 워크플로우에서도 활용할 수 있도록 생산성을 높여줍니다.

프롬프트 목록

저장소에 명시적인 프롬프트 템플릿이 언급되어 있지 않습니다.

FlowHunt 로고

비즈니스 성장 준비가 되셨나요?

오늘 무료 평가판을 시작하고 며칠 내로 결과를 확인하세요.

리소스 목록

공식 문서에 특정 MCP “리소스"가 나열되어 있지 않습니다.

도구 목록

  • SOQL 쿼리 실행
    LLM이 세일즈포스 데이터에 대해 SOQL 쿼리를 실행할 수 있도록 지원합니다.
  • SOSL 검색 실행
    여러 오브젝트에서 텍스트를 대상으로 SOSL 검색을 수행할 수 있도록 허용합니다.
  • 메타데이터 조회
    오브젝트의 필드명, 라벨, 타입 등 세일즈포스 오브젝트 관련 메타데이터를 가져옵니다.
  • 레코드 관리
    세일즈포스 레코드의 조회, 생성, 수정, 삭제를 지원합니다.
  • Tooling API 요청 실행
    고급 개발과 디버깅을 위한 세일즈포스 Tooling API 요청을 실행할 수 있습니다.
  • Apex REST 요청 실행
    세일즈포스에 노출된 커스텀 Apex REST 엔드포인트를 사용할 수 있습니다.
  • 직접 REST API 호출
    세일즈포스에 직접 REST API 호출을 하여 맞춤형 통합을 손쉽게 할 수 있습니다.

이 MCP 서버의 활용 사례

  • 자동화된 세일즈포스 데이터베이스 관리
    LLM을 이용해 프로그래밍 방식으로 세일즈포스 레코드를 쿼리, 갱신, 생성, 삭제하여 CRM 데이터 운영을 간소화합니다.
  • 세일즈포스 개발자를 위한 코드베이스 탐색
    오브젝트 메타데이터를 조회하고 오브젝트 및 필드 구조를 탐색해 빠른 개발과 디버깅을 지원합니다.
  • API 통합 및 오케스트레이션
    AI 에이전트를 통해 세일즈포스 REST 및 Tooling API 호출을 워크플로우 자동화의 일부로 오케스트레이션할 수 있습니다.
  • 세일즈포스 데이터 검색 및 리포팅
    자연어로 강력한 텍스트 검색과 구조화 쿼리를 실행하여 분석 또는 리포트 목적으로 세일즈포스 인사이트를 도출할 수 있습니다.
  • 자동화 테스트 및 모니터링
    Tooling API 및 Apex REST 엔드포인트를 활용해 자동화된 테스트 시나리오, 시스템 상태 모니터링, 커스텀 로직 트리거 등을 구현할 수 있습니다.

설정 방법

Windsurf

  1. uvx와 MCP 세일즈포스 커넥터가 설치되어 있는지 확인하세요.

  2. Windsurf 설정 파일(예: windsurf_config.json)을 여세요.

  3. mcpServers 섹션에 세일즈포스 MCP 서버를 추가하세요:

    {
      "mcpServers": {
        "salesforce": {
          "command": "uvx",
          "args": [
            "--from",
            "mcp-salesforce-connector",
            "salesforce"
          ],
          "env": {
            "SALESFORCE_ACCESS_TOKEN": "SALESFORCE_ACCESS_TOKEN",
            "SALESFORCE_INSTANCE_URL": "SALESFORCE_INSTANCE_URL"
          }
        }
      }
    }
    
  4. 설정을 저장하고 Windsurf를 재시작하세요.

  5. 테스트 세일즈포스 쿼리를 실행해 정상 동작을 확인하세요.

참고: 위와 같이 환경 변수를 사용해 세일즈포스 자격 증명을 안전하게 관리하세요.

Claude

  1. uvx를 설치하고 MCP 세일즈포스 커넥터가 사용 가능한지 확인하세요.

  2. claude_desktop_config.json 파일을 수정하세요.

  3. mcpServers 아래에 다음을 추가하세요:

    {
      "mcpServers": {
        "salesforce": {
          "command": "uvx",
          "args": [
            "--from",
            "mcp-salesforce-connector",
            "salesforce"
          ],
          "env": {
            "SALESFORCE_ACCESS_TOKEN": "SALESFORCE_ACCESS_TOKEN",
            "SALESFORCE_INSTANCE_URL": "SALESFORCE_INSTANCE_URL"
          }
        }
      }
    }
    
  4. 변경 사항을 저장하고 Claude를 재시작하세요.

  5. SOQL 쿼리를 실행해 서버 연결을 확인하세요.

참고: 세일즈포스 자격 증명은 반드시 환경 변수로 관리하세요.

Cursor

  1. uvx와 세일즈포스 MCP 커넥터를 설치하세요.

  2. Cursor MCP 설정 파일에 접근하세요.

  3. mcpServers 섹션에 세일즈포스 서버를 추가하세요:

    {
      "mcpServers": {
        "salesforce": {
          "command": "uvx",
          "args": [
            "--from",
            "mcp-salesforce-connector",
            "salesforce"
          ],
          "env": {
            "SALESFORCE_ACCESS_TOKEN": "SALESFORCE_ACCESS_TOKEN",
            "SALESFORCE_INSTANCE_URL": "SALESFORCE_INSTANCE_URL"
          }
        }
      }
    }
    
  4. 저장 후 Cursor를 재시작하세요.

  5. 샘플 세일즈포스 작업으로 테스트하세요.

참고: 위와 같이 환경 변수로 API 키를 안전하게 관리하세요.

Cline

  1. 필수 구성요소(uvx와 커넥터 패키지)를 설치하세요.

  2. Cline MCP 설정 파일을 수정하세요.

  3. 다음 설정을 삽입하세요:

    {
      "mcpServers": {
        "salesforce": {
          "command": "uvx",
          "args": [
            "--from",
            "mcp-salesforce-connector",
            "salesforce"
          ],
          "env": {
            "SALESFORCE_ACCESS_TOKEN": "SALESFORCE_ACCESS_TOKEN",
            "SALESFORCE_INSTANCE_URL": "SALESFORCE_INSTANCE_URL"
          }
        }
      }
    }
    
  4. Cline을 재시작하고 서버가 활성화되어 있는지 확인하세요.

  5. 기본 세일즈포스 REST API 호출로 검증하세요.

참고: “env” 섹션에서 항상 환경 변수로 자격 증명을 안전하게 관리하세요.

예시: API 키 보안 설정

{
  "mcpServers": {
    "salesforce": {
      "command": "uvx",
      "args": [
        "--from",
        "mcp-salesforce-connector",
        "salesforce"
      ],
      "env": {
        "SALESFORCE_ACCESS_TOKEN": "your-access-token-here",
        "SALESFORCE_INSTANCE_URL": "https://your-instance.salesforce.com"
      }
    }
  }
}

이 MCP를 플로우에 사용하는 방법

FlowHunt에서 MCP 사용하기

FlowHunt 워크플로우에 MCP 서버를 통합하려면, MCP 컴포넌트를 플로우에 추가하고 AI 에이전트와 연결하세요:

FlowHunt MCP flow

MCP 컴포넌트를 클릭해 설정 패널을 엽니다. 시스템 MCP 설정 섹션에서 다음과 같은 JSON 포맷으로 MCP 서버 정보를 입력하세요:

{
  "salesforce": {
    "transport": "streamable_http",
    "url": "https://yourmcpserver.example/pathtothemcp/url"
  }
}

설정이 완료되면 AI 에이전트가 MCP의 모든 기능과 역량에 접근할 수 있습니다. “salesforce” 부분은 실제 MCP 서버 이름으로, URL은 본인의 MCP 서버 URL로 변경하세요.


개요

섹션제공 여부세부 내용/비고
개요README.md에 설명
프롬프트 목록명시적 프롬프트 템플릿 없음
리소스 목록MCP “리소스” 명시 없음
도구 목록README.md에 도구 기능 설명
API 키 보안환경 변수 사용법 안내
샘플링 지원(평가에 중요하지 않음)언급 없음

위 표를 종합하면, 세일즈포스 MCP 서버는 설정 문서화가 잘 되어 있고 도구에 대한 설명도 명확하지만, 프롬프트 템플릿, 리소스 프리미티브, 샘플링/루트 지원에 대한 명시적인 정보는 부족합니다. 개발자 지향적이고 인증 설정이 명확하다는 장점이 있으나, MCP 표준에서 요구하는 모든 기능을 갖춘 것은 아닙니다.


MCP 점수

라이선스 보유✅ (MIT)
도구 1개 이상 보유
포크 수37
스타 수96

자주 묻는 질문

FlowHunt로 세일즈포스 워크플로우를 강화하세요

FlowHunt의 세일즈포스 MCP 서버를 이용해 AI 에이전트를 세일즈포스에 연결하여 데이터 관리, 자동화된 인사이트, 강력한 통합을 경험하세요.

더 알아보기

Solr 검색 MCP 서버
Solr 검색 MCP 서버

Solr 검색 MCP 서버

Solr 검색 MCP 서버는 대형 언어 모델(LLM)과 Apache Solr를 통합하여, Model Context Protocol(MCP)을 통해 Solr 컬렉션에서 직접 문서를 안전하게 인증된 방식으로 타입 세이프하게 검색 및 조회할 수 있도록 합니다. 엔터프라이즈급 검색, 고급 필터...

4 분 읽기
MCP Server Apache Solr +4
MCP 프록시 서버
MCP 프록시 서버

MCP 프록시 서버

MCP 프록시 서버는 여러 MCP 리소스 서버를 하나의 HTTP 서버로 통합하여 AI 어시스턴트와 개발자를 위한 연결을 간소화합니다. 다양한 도구, API, 데이터 소스에 실시간 스트리밍과 중앙 집중식 인증으로 통합 접근을 제공합니다....

4 분 읽기
AI Infrastructure +4
JDBC MCP 서버 통합
JDBC MCP 서버 통합

JDBC MCP 서버 통합

JDBC MCP 서버는 JDBC 프로토콜을 사용하여 AI 어시스턴트와 SQL 데이터베이스를 연결해 주며, 실시간 쿼리, 분석 자동화, 그리고 FlowHunt 및 기타 AI 기반 환경 내에서 데이터베이스 관리의 효율화를 가능하게 합니다....

4 분 읽기
MCP Server JDBC +5